"Shani"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ote in message news:[EMAIL PROTECTED] > I have the following code which takes a list of urls > "http://google.com", without the quotes ofcourse, and then saves there > source code as a text file. I wan to alter the code so that for the > list of URLs an html file is saved. > > -----begin----- > import urllib > urlfile = open(r'c:\temp\url.txt', 'r') > for lines in urlfile: > try: > outfilename = lines.replace('/', '-') > urllib.urlretrieve(lines.strip('/n'), 'c:\\temp\\' \ > + outfilename.strip('\n')[7:] + '.txt') > except: > pass > -----end----- > Or is this what you mean? -----begin----- import urllib urlfile = open('c:\\temp\\url.txt', 'r') newurlfile = open('c:\\temp\\newurls.html', 'w') newurlfile.write('<html> \n<body>\n') for lines in urlfile: try: if lines == '\n': pass else: lines = '<a href="' + lines.strip() +'">'\ + lines.strip() + '</a>' + '<br>\n' newurlfile.write(lines) except: pass newurlfile.write('</body> \n</html>') urlfile.close() newurlfile.close() -----end----- Louis
